HR 2301 104th Congress Government Operations and Politics

To designate an enclosed area of the Oak Ridge National Laboratory in Oak Ridge, Tennessee as the "Marilyn Lloyd Environmental, Life, and Social Sciences Complex".

Introduced: September 12, 1995 See on congress.gov
This bill died when the 104th Congress ended
It never became law before the 104th Congress (1995–1996) adjourned, and bills don't carry over to the next Congress. It would have to be reintroduced. You can still save it for reference, but it won't receive updates.
